this morning around 9.15 a largish raptor sent all the cockatoos and wood ducks around royal canberra golf course into a panic.  I only got a brief look before it went behind tree tops but it registered as a Little Eagle.
 
Around midday over in West Stromlo  I came across a small group of Yellow faced H/e on the move – not the sort of weather that we would normally associate with the start of the migration but I note that J. Casburn also saw a group today near Duffy.
